**Ticket: SEC-331 — Typo-Squat Package Scanner**

For weekly sync: the CrateSentry scanner flags lookalike names in our internal registry but misses single-character swaps and homoglyphs. Scope: add edit-distance and Unicode confusable checks, plus an allowlist for known forks. Blocking releases until false-negative rate is measured. Needs a decision on quarantine-vs-warn behavior this week. No rollout without sign-off. The required approver is named below.

account owner for bawip-tahag: Raleth Quenok

Subject: LiftSim 2.9.1 released to staging

This release updates the elevator-dispatch simulator's morning-peak heuristics and fixes the stalled-car deadlock reported last sprint. No schema migrations are required. On-call: if dispatch latency alarms fire after rollout, roll back to 2.9.0 using the standard procedure; the simulator tolerates mixed versions for up to an hour. Canary metrics will appear on the Northquay dashboard within ten minutes of deploy. For incident reports, reference the build token that follows.

build token for tawip-yageg: htk9_92ac43d42

Handover note — Crumbwheel order cutoffs.

Welcome aboard. The bakery cutoff rule in Crumbwheel closes same-day orders at 14:00 local to each storefront, not UTC — this has bitten us twice. Holiday overrides live in the calendar service and take precedence silently, so always check there first when a cutoff looks wrong. To unlock the calendar service's admin console after a restart, enter the recovery passphrase below.

vault phrase of bagap-bahaf = silion-pelox-sorox-casdor-quenwyn-fraax-eliox-praael-kelion-quenvan-kasox-rusael-norius-belvan

# Break-Glass: Catalog Cache Invalidation

Scope: the Pinrow product catalog at Veldstone Retail. If stale prices persist after a purge and the Hollowmere invalidation queue is wedged, use break-glass to flush the edge tier directly. Contractors: get verbal sign-off from the catalog lead first. Steps: open the Hollowmere admin shell, select emergency-flush, confirm the tenant, and run it once — repeated flushes thrash the origin. Access is logged and expires after 20 minutes. Unseal the admin shell with the passphrase below.

recovery phrase for kahop-tajog: istix-casvan